i had starting issues with a 96 850r, after all the usual culprits were ruled out, decided it was a transponder/immobiliser/key issue.
i spent days ringing key cutters and trawling the net to get a key cut and programmed, and as pedro said, only to be told (even by the 'dodgy' ones) that only volvo had the software to do it. volvo stoke:........£80.00 per key plus an hours labour (bout £45) plus they will need the car to do it!!!
this was over a year ago though, so you could drop lucky with a key cutter who has....ahem!!...acquired the relevant software in the meantime.

I have had a key cut successfully at Timsons, so it might be worth a try.

That was for my 1997 V70 T5, but they couldn't duplicate the S70R key or the key for my Dad's 1998 S70 - they are dealer only for some reason.

MRG Volvo in Chippenham made a duplicate key for the S70R for £35 last year. They'll need the car there for coding.
